Abstract EN
Solar energy production and economic evaluation are analyzed, in this study, by using daily solar radiation and average temperature data which are measured for 3 years in the Osmaniye province in Turkey.
Besides, this study utilizes the photovoltaic- (PV-) based grid connected to a power plant which has an installed capacity of 1 MW investment in electricity production.
Economic values show that the net present value (NPV), the first economic method in the research, is about 111941 USD, which is greater than zero.
Therefore, the payback year of this investment is approximately 8.3.
The second one of these methods, the payback period of the simple payback period (PBP), is 6.27 years.
The last method, which is the mean value of the internal rate of return (IRR), is 10.36%.
The results of this study show that Osmaniye is a considerable region for the PV investment in electricity production.
As a result, investment of a PV system in Osmaniye can be applicable.
